I recently noticed while on 80 cw with a watt meter attached, that my output on 80 cw was only about 2 to 3 watts at the low end of the band, even though the drive setting was for about 12 watts. I can't say I that I have checked the output on 80 cw recently, so this may not be new. I built and aligned the K2 about a year ago and have the built-in tuner installed. I re-checked it with a dummy load and got the same results. If I tune to the center of the band the output goes up. At the high end, it also appears to drop off. Other bands seem OK. I intend to open it up and peak the alignment, but before I do that, is there anything else I should be looking for?

Phil,
The first thing to check is the bandpass filter for 80 meters. Check that L5 is properly soldered and has a value of 33 uHy. Recheck the BPF peaking using a transmit power of 1.5 watts. Normally, the response across 80 meters is rather flat, and I suspect that you have a problem with the coupling element in the BPF, namely L5. Another thing to check is the VCO voltage (R30 voltage) at both ends of 80 meters - if it drops below 1.5 volts at the low end or goes above 6.5 volts at the high end, you have a problem with the VCO range. 73, Don W3FPR Phil Zminda wrote: > I recently noticed while on 80 cw with a watt meter attached, that my output on 80 cw was only about 2 to 3 watts at the low end of the band, even though the drive setting was for about 12 watts.
